Jones Lang LaSalle Building Maintenance Manager in New York, New York

What this job involves -
In collaboration with the Senior Facilities Manager/Facilities Manager/Assistant Facilities Manager and Engineering Manager in managing the engineering services operation and maintenance of two assigned buildings. Provides direct support to field operations, performance metric tracking and reporting, implements strategic material acquisition strategies.Your day to day:
Manage and oversee a team of 4-6 techs throughout the NYC area
Be team expert in General Maintenance repairs and services.
Gather thorough and concise quotes for outsourced work
Communicate clearly and often with Managers
Maintain staffing schedules, timekeeping and performance records for techs and prioritize maintenance projects for the staff
Furnish mechanics with basic data required in effecting overall and long-range planning.
Make recommendations for systems improvement and Capital Projects through immediate supervisor or management.
Furnish the Senior Facilities Manager/Facilities Manager/Assistant Facilities Manager with information relative to criticality of buildings.
Maintain liaison with Facilities Manager/Assistant Facilities Manager regarding work orders, job completion dates and priorities and estimates.
Supports preparation of monthly/quarterly operations reports.
Plan schedule of work in accordance with established priorities.
Coordinate purchasing and inventory control procedures.
Respond effectively to all emergencies.
Perform onsite Quality Assurance inspections of maintained facilities as required
Any and all other duties and tasks assignedSound like you? To apply you need:
High School degree or equivalent GED (preferred)
4 years managerial experience
4 years of technical experience in building engineering with a strong background in technical aspects of repair and building maintenance.Experience and technical skills Required
Working knowledge of computer based applications and programs, Excel and Word required.
Position requires excellent communication skills in English, both oral and written.
Possess advanced mechanical and electrical aptitude
